一个类可以是多个一般类的特殊类,它从多个一般类中继承了属性和操作,这种继承模式叫()。

题目
填空题
一个类可以是多个一般类的特殊类,它从多个一般类中继承了属性和操作,这种继承模式叫()。
如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

下列描述中错误的是( )。

A.析构函数可以被继承

B.虚函数不能被继承

C.派生类可以有多个基类

D.纯虚基类的子类可以是虚基类


正确答案:B
解析: 本题考查关于C++语言基类中虚函数的继承问题。C++语言中基类的虚函数是可以被派生类继承的。

第2题:

如果一个派生类只有一个直接基类,则该类的继承方式称为【 】继承;如果一个派生类同时有多个直接基类,则该类的继承方式称为【 】继承。


正确答案:单 多
单 多 解析:从派生类的角度,根据它所拥有的基类数目不同,可以分为单继承和多继承。一个类只有一个直接基类时,称为单继承;而一个类同时有多个直接基类时,则称为多继承。

第3题:

● 以下关于面向对象方法中继承的叙述中,错误的是 (22) 。

(22)

A. 继承是父类和子类之间共享数据和方法的机制

B. 继承定义了类与类之间的一种关系

C. 继承关系中的子类将拥有父类的全部属性和方法

D. 继承仅仅允许单重继承,即不允许一个子类有多个父类


正确答案:D
c

第4题:

从一个基类派生的继承为单继承,从多个基类派生的继承为()。


正确答案:多继承

第5题:

一个类可以是多个一般类的特殊类,它从多个一般类中继承了属性和操作,这种继承模式叫()。


正确答案:多继承

第6题:

下面关于继承的叙述正确的是 ( )

A.在Java中类间只允许单一继承

B.在Java中一个类只能实现一个接口

C.在Java中一个类不能同时继承一个类和实现一个接口

D.在Java中一个类可以同时继承多个类


正确答案:A
解析:该题考查的是类的继承。继承分为单继承和多继承两种形式。单继承允许一个类可以有多个子类,但只能有一个父类;多继承则允许一个类不仅可以有多个子类,还可以有多个父类。但需要注意一点,Java只支持单继承,但可以通过接口实现多继承的功能。一个类可以同时继承一个类和实现一个接口。所以选项A是正确的。

第7题:

Python是一门面向对象的语言,支持以下哪些继承方式:()

  • A、单继承:一个类继承自单个基类
  • B、多继承:一个类继承自多个基类
  • C、分层继承:多个类继承自单个基类
  • D、混合继承:两种或多种类型继承的混合

正确答案:A,B,C,D

第8题:

在面向对象的开发方法中,类的继承机制是( )

A. 子类不可继承超类的属性,但可以继承超类的操作和约束规则

B. 子类可以继承超类的属性,但不可以继承超类的操作和约束规则

C. 如果一个对象类中加入新对象,则它可自动地继承本对象类的全部属性、操作和约束规则

D. 超类也可以继承另一个超类的属性和操作、约束规则


正确答案:C

第9题:

在面向对象的方法中,子类可以继承()。

  • A、一个超类的属性
  • B、一个超类的属性、操作和约束规则
  • C、多个超类的属性、操作和约束规则
  • D、多个子类的属性和操作

正确答案:C

第10题:

Java程序中,定义一个类时,可以从多个父类继承。


正确答案:错误

更多相关问题